Hey everyone, ever wonder how complex railway schedules are managed? It's a huge challenge, but IQM and Deutsche Bahn are tackling it head-on with quantum computing! They've successfully demonstrated a quantum algorithm using real operational data to optimize train scheduling. This isn't just theory; it's a practical step towards making train travel smoother and more efficient for millions.
